The … Web6 mrt. 2024 · Method 1: Run System File Checker (SFC) scan: 1. Search for 'command prompt' using Cortana or Windows Search. 2. From results, right click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ator. 3. Type sfc /scannow command and press Enter key. 4. Let the command complete and then reboot the machine.
